Output 68970d7ec083d4e15c4c511328b82094d3860cacc4baf736a0012d6190894010:1

value
52263955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f5e5e1b3d5d47a374ab757e0b7b58f73df8865d OP_EQUAL
address
34YsvGQoDWQA2PKN8WtyB8a1Hxe1U3HHjx
transaction
68970d7ec083d4e15c4c511328b82094d3860cacc4baf736a0012d6190894010
spent
true